UMBC professor Sunil Dasgupta ended his local public affairs podcast I Hate Politics after a five-year, 420 episode run on June 30.
He said improved local media coverage made the show less necessary as he looks forward to his next adventure.
Work continues on Maryland’s first Xi’an Famous Foods in Rockville—construction remains in early stages as a $100,000 permit was issued for interior work at Montrose Crossing next to RASA and Five Guys, and the restaurant may open later this year.
Kareem’s Lebanese Kitchen is now open at Rio in Gaithersburg after a weeklong soft opening and offers Lebanese favorites like hummus, shawarma, and grilled entrées.
Located at 212 Boardwalk Place in a former music school, the restaurant honors Chef Rachid’s family heritage (celebrating Beirut’s culinary tradition).
Gaithersburg’s Café Sophie, a European-style café at the Montgomery County Airpark, will be featured on WETA PBS’ Emmy Award-winning series 'Signature Dish' in an episode called 'Exploring Europe' (premiering Monday, Sept.
7, at 9pm on WETA PBS and 8pm on WETA Metro, plus streaming on WETA+).
A report from personal finance firm WalletHub released on Aug.
24 found that Maryland ranked as the 14th-hardest working state, placing second for average commute time and 11th for daily leisure time.
Montgomery County Public Schools is studying possible closings and consolidations for elementary and middle schools today because enrollment has dropped over the past year — more details will be shared on Oct.
8 and public sessions will run from late Oct. through January with any changes set to start in 2029-30.
The Maryland Department of Natural Resources reopened Hunting Creek Lake and parts of Cunningham Falls State Park in Thurmont on Monday after monitoring found no further rabid beaver activity+ Portions of Seneca Creek State Park near Darnestown remain closed as officials continue to check for safety.
Maryland agriculture officials have set up quarantines in several counties to slow the spread of the box tree moth, which can quickly kill boxwood plants.
Expert Mike Raupp advises homeowners to inspect their boxwoods for signs of silk webbing and caterpillars that may indicate an infestation.

Montgomery County clarifies that the MMR vaccine remains one shot and fully covered to ease parent concerns before school starts.
Free student vaccination clinics (through Sept. 25) are available for families needing support.
